Two Graduate Fellows in Russian and German

Trinity College expects to hire two Graduate Fellows, one in Russian and one in German, for 2007-2008.  To be eligible, candidates must be doctoral students with ABD status and working on a Ph.D. at a North American University.  The Fellows teach one course each semester and are responsible for a vigorous program of cultural events on and off campus.  The Fellows live on campus in an apartment provided by the college and in addition receive a stipend of about $16,900.  Medical benefits are included.
